Sabine Toesca, treasurer of Fight Aids Monaco: a couple rooted in charity
For the Toescas, public appearances are not just about party photos. Sabine is not just a “wife” in the background. She holds the position of treasurer of Fight Aids Monaco, the association founded by Princess Stéphanie to fight against HIV.
This role involves concrete financial management, a long-term commitment, and regular attendance at charitable events in the Principality. The couple was photographed together at the Fight Aids Monaco summer evening at the Sporting Club of Monaco in July 2021, and then at the Fight Aids Cup at the Sporting Club of Monte-Carlo in January 2026.
This shared charitable positioning clearly distinguishes the Toescas from other media couples. When one looks into Marc Toesca’s couple life, one finds more traces of shared commitment than sentimental revelations.

Engagement rumors and the mechanics of celebrity sites
The Toesca case illustrates a well-documented phenomenon in online press. Sites publish a rumor (engagement, separation, new project) and then a correction a few hours later, generating two waves of traffic on the same non-event.

In September 2026, the engagement rumor followed exactly this pattern. Marc Toesca, 70 years old, was reportedly seen with his partner at a jeweler. The correction arrived quickly, clarifying that it was likely a misunderstanding. This rumor-denial cycle fuels Google searches without providing any verifiable information.
